  • Your Rainbow Panorama

    “Your Rainbow Panorama” is a permanent installation on the roof top of  ARoS Museum in Aarhus, Denmark. It is done by Olafur Eliasson, which is a studio consisting of  around 45 people whom include craftsmen and specialized technicians, to architects, artists, archivists and art historians, cooks, and administrators. “Your rainbow panorama” has a diameter of 52 meters and ...

  • 3 Million Year Old Ice Cave In the province of Shanxi, North China

    Here are some pictures of a 3 million year old Cave that Is located in China’s North province of Shanxi. The Ice Cave is more than 100 meters long and it remains frozen and covered in ice all year long. The Ice cave has been illuminated with different colourful lights and has become an attractive tourist destination, ...
